As part of A.P. Moller – Maersk’s continuous efforts to improve reliability and enable better supply chain planning for our customers across the network, SLB North Sea Service will stop calling London Gateway and will be calling Tilbury instead. This adjustment is aimed at providing a stable and reliable product to and from the UK market.

The new service rotation for the SLB service will be as follow:
Tilbury – Rotterdam – Bremerhaven – Antwerp – Ashdod – Alexandria - Port Said East - Tilbury

The first vessel planned to call Tilbury will be VAYENGA MAERSK-604S, ETD 18th of January 2026, please note that we may use the option to call Tilbury before the official date.
